MetadataSerializationContext.ReadFromDocument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Перегрузки
ReadFromDocument(String, TextReader, Encoding) |
Прочитайте содержимое документа, предоставленного указанным средством чтения, и сохраните его в контексте в указанном логическом пути. |
ReadFromDocument(String, Stream) |
Прочитайте содержимое документа, предоставленного указанным потоком, и сохраните его в контексте в указанном логическом пути. |
ReadFromDocument(Stream) |
Прочитайте содержимое документа, предоставленного указанным потоком, и сохраните его в контексте. |
ReadFromDocument(TextReader, Encoding) |
Прочтите содержимое документа, предоставленного указанным средством чтения, и сохраните его в контексте. |
ReadFromDocument(String, TextReader, Encoding)
Прочитайте содержимое документа, предоставленного указанным средством чтения, и сохраните его в контексте в указанном логическом пути.
public Microsoft.AnalysisServices.Tabular.Serialization.MetadataDocument ReadFromDocument (string logicalPath, System.IO.TextReader reader, System.Text.Encoding encoding = default);
member this.ReadFromDocument : string * System.IO.TextReader * System.Text.Encoding -> Microsoft.AnalysisServices.Tabular.Serialization.MetadataDocument
Public Function ReadFromDocument (logicalPath As String, reader As TextReader, Optional encoding As Encoding = Nothing) As MetadataDocument
Параметры
- logicalPath
- String
Логический путь, который можно использовать для получения содержимого в наборе документов в контексте.
- reader
- TextReader
TextReader, предоставляющий доступ к содержимому.
- encoding
- Encoding
Необязательный Encoding, который следует использовать при хранении содержимого в контексте.
Возвращаемое значение
MetadataDocument, которые можно использовать для доступа к загруженном содержимому документа.
Исключения
- Указанный путь — это пустая ссылка (Nothing в Visual Basic) или пустая.
- Указанный документ является пустой ссылкой (Nothing в Visual Basic).
Указанный путь уже существует в контексте.
Применяется к
ReadFromDocument(String, Stream)
Прочитайте содержимое документа, предоставленного указанным потоком, и сохраните его в контексте в указанном логическом пути.
public Microsoft.AnalysisServices.Tabular.Serialization.MetadataDocument ReadFromDocument (string logicalPath, System.IO.Stream document);
member this.ReadFromDocument : string * System.IO.Stream -> Microsoft.AnalysisServices.Tabular.Serialization.MetadataDocument
Public Function ReadFromDocument (logicalPath As String, document As Stream) As MetadataDocument
Параметры
- logicalPath
- String
Логический путь, который можно использовать для получения содержимого в наборе документов в контексте.
Возвращаемое значение
MetadataDocument, которые можно использовать для доступа к загруженном содержимому документа.
Исключения
- Указанный путь — это пустая ссылка (Nothing в Visual Basic) или пустая.
- Указанный документ является пустой ссылкой (Nothing в Visual Basic).
- Указанный путь уже существует в контексте.
- Указанный документ не поддерживает чтение из него.
Применяется к
ReadFromDocument(Stream)
Прочитайте содержимое документа, предоставленного указанным потоком, и сохраните его в контексте.
public Microsoft.AnalysisServices.Tabular.Serialization.MetadataDocument ReadFromDocument (System.IO.Stream document);
member this.ReadFromDocument : System.IO.Stream -> Microsoft.AnalysisServices.Tabular.Serialization.MetadataDocument
Public Function ReadFromDocument (document As Stream) As MetadataDocument
Параметры
Возвращаемое значение
MetadataDocument, которые можно использовать для доступа к загруженном содержимому документа.
Исключения
Указанный документ является пустой ссылкой (Nothing в Visual Basic).
Указанный документ не поддерживает чтение из него.
Применяется к
ReadFromDocument(TextReader, Encoding)
Прочтите содержимое документа, предоставленного указанным средством чтения, и сохраните его в контексте.
public Microsoft.AnalysisServices.Tabular.Serialization.MetadataDocument ReadFromDocument (System.IO.TextReader reader, System.Text.Encoding encoding = default);
member this.ReadFromDocument : System.IO.TextReader * System.Text.Encoding -> Microsoft.AnalysisServices.Tabular.Serialization.MetadataDocument
Public Function ReadFromDocument (reader As TextReader, Optional encoding As Encoding = Nothing) As MetadataDocument
Параметры
- reader
- TextReader
TextReader, предоставляющий доступ к содержимому.
- encoding
- Encoding
Необязательный Encoding, который следует использовать при хранении содержимого в контексте.
Возвращаемое значение
MetadataDocument, которые можно использовать для доступа к загруженном содержимому документа.
Исключения
Указанное средство чтения является пустой ссылкой (Nothing в Visual Basic).